13.07.2015 Views

MPLAB ICD 3 In-Circuit Debugger User's Guide

MPLAB ICD 3 In-Circuit Debugger User's Guide

MPLAB ICD 3 In-Circuit Debugger User's Guide

SHOW MORE
SHOW LESS
  • No tags were found...

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

<strong>Debugger</strong> Function Summary9.3.1.2 BREAKPOINT DIALOG BUTTONSUse the buttons to add a breakpoint and set up additional break conditions. Also, astopwatch is available for use with breakpoints and triggers.Note:Buttons displayed will depend on the selected device.TABLE 9-2: BREAKPOINT DIALOG BUTTONSControl Function Related DialogAdd Breakpoint Add a breakpoint Section 9.3.2 “Set BreakpointDialog”Stopwatch Set up the stopwatch Section 9.3.3 “Stopwatch Dialog”Event Breakpoints Set up break on an event Section 9.3.4 “Event BreakpointsDialog”Sequenced Breakpoints Set up a sequence until break Section 9.3.5 “SequencedBreakpoints Dialog”ANDed Breakpoints Set up ANDed condition untilbreakSection 9.3.6 “ANDed BreakpointsDialog”9.3.2 Set Breakpoint DialogClick Add Breakpoint in the Breakpoints Dialog to display this dialog.Select a breakpoint for the Breakpoints dialog here.9.3.2.1 PROGRAM MEMORY TABSet up a program memory breakpoint here.TABLE 9-3: PROGRAM MEMORY BREAKPOINTControlFunctionAddressLocation of breakpoint in hexBreakpoint Type The type of program memory breakpoint. See the device datasheet for more information on table reads/writes.Program Memory Execution – break on execution of aboveaddressTBLRD Program Memory – break on table read of above addressTBLWT Program Memory – break on table write to above addressPass CountBreak on pass count condition.Always break – always break as specified in “Breakpoint type”Break occurs Count instructions after Event – wait Count (0-255)instructions before breaking after event specified in “Breakpointtype”Event must occur Count times – break only after event specified in“Breakpoint type” occurs Count (0-255) times© 2008 Microchip Technology <strong>In</strong>c. DS51766A-page 69

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!